Illinois 2025-2026 Regular Session

Illinois House Bill HB5396

Introduced
2/6/26  

Caption

HEALTHY SOILS TASK FORCE

Impact

This bill will likely have significant implications for state agricultural policies and environmental regulations. The establishment of the Healthy Soils Task Force will bring together stakeholders from various sectors, including agriculture, environmental science, and policy-making. By fostering collaboration, the bill seeks to identify practical measures to improve soil conditions, which may include best practices for land management and techniques for promoting carbon sequestration. The recommendations made by this Task Force could lead to new guidelines or legislative initiatives aimed at better protecting Illinois' soil resources.

Summary

House Bill 5396 establishes the Healthy Soils Task Force with the objective of developing strategies and recommendations to improve soil health across Illinois. The bill emphasizes the importance of healthy soils in achieving broader environmental goals, such as enhancing agricultural productivity, reducing carbon emissions, and promoting sustainable farming practices. By focusing on soil health, HB5396 aims to address the urgent need for soil restoration and conservation methods that can mitigate climate change effects and improve food security.
